Ahuva - Meaning of Ahuva
What does Ahuva mean?
[ 3 syll. a-hu-va, ah-uva ] The baby girl name Ahuva is pronounced as aa-HH-uwVAA- †. Ahuva is largely used in the Hebrew language and its origin is also Hebrew. Ahuva is a variant transcription of the name Achava (Hebrew).
See also the related category hebrew.
Ahuva is rare as a baby girl name. It is not listed in the top 1000.
